How Boston grades restaurants
Boston reports inspections as a pass or a fail, with no score and no letter. What separates a bad fail from a trivial one is the violation severity ladder: a single star is a minor issue, two stars is more serious, and three stars marks a critical foodborne-illness risk factor — temperature abuse, bad handwashing, cross-contamination. A restaurant can fail on paperwork alone, which is not the same as failing on food safety. Cooked splits Boston fails accordingly: a fail with a three-star violation reads cooked, a fail on minor items only reads mid.
